Rode my first bike home from dealership...CWW to Dufferin St...kept riding past home and hit a little twist in the road a bit quick and scared my self. Ran that little twist many many times after at higher speeds, so it became my "test" spot...lol
My wife got her bike just before I did, but I rode her tiny Virago 250 home from CWE. First time riding a motorcycle on the street after taking the M1X course.
Within 5 minutes of leaving the store I was on the 401 struggling to do 100 km/h in top gear, while everyone around me was whizzing past me at 120... Holy fork, that was intense! Exhilarating, but still intense!